BWH Hotels Teams Up With Tesla To Offer EV Charging Stations

BWH Hotels has announced a partnership with Tesla TSLA to install electric vehicle (EV) charging stations at selected properties across North America starting in 2024.

What Happened: Hotel News Resource reported that the collaboration will leverage Tesla’s Universal Wall Connectors, compatible with all North American vehicle models, underscoring BWH Hotels’ commitment to sustainability and enhanced guest experiences.

Michael Morton, Vice President of Brand Management and Member Services at BWH Hotels, highlighted the initiative as a blend of eco-conscious efforts and quality guest services. Additionally, the brand’s Earth, People, and Community (EPC) effort focuses on environmental stewardship and community engagement.

Travelers will soon be able to filter BWH Hotels’ website results for properties with Tesla charging stations.

Why It Matters: This move by BWH Hotels is a significant step in the hospitality industry’s adaptation to the growing EV market. It follows similar initiatives by other major players, including EG Group’s partnership with Tesla for EV charging expansion in Europe.

Additionally, Ford Motor Co F has expanded its charging network, incorporating Tesla superchargers, reflecting an industry-wide emphasis on enhancing EV infrastructure to support sustainable transportation. The growing network of EV charging stations, now including BWH Hotels, plays a crucial role in reducing range anxiety and promoting the adoption of electric vehicles.

Notably, Tesla has also opened its supercharger stations to rival EVs in the United States, a development lauded by President Joe Biden and indicative of the broader shift towards electric vehicles. Tesla’s move to open its network reflects a commitment to advancing sustainable energy and supporting the global transition to electric vehicles.
